色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

php is weixin

錢斌斌1年前6瀏覽0評論

PHP語言開發的微信公眾平臺,以簡單易用的特點受到了大量開發者的青睞。與微信官方提供的基于Java的SDK相比,PHP的應用更加輕便,方便開發者進行二次開發。通過PHP語言開發微信公眾平臺,可以實現多種功能,如微信菜單、自動回復、消息推送、數據統計等。下面,我們將對PHP語言開發的微信公眾平臺進行詳細介紹。

首先,我們可以通過PHP語言來開發微信菜單。微信菜單是微信公眾號的基礎組成部分,可以方便快捷地提供各類服務。通過PHP開發的微信菜單可以同時支持菜單自定義,滿足用戶需求,以及菜單切換,一鍵切換菜單,方便操作。例如,用戶可以通過菜單進行信息查詢、功能選擇、網站跳轉等,滿足不同用戶的需求。

<?php
// 聲明PHP數組
$buttons = array(
array(
'name' =>'基礎',
'sub_button' =>array(
array('type' =>'click', 'name' =>'綁定賬戶','key'  =>'BIND_ACCOUNT'),
array('type' =>'view', 'name' =>'使用教程','url'  =>'http://www.example.com/help'),
array('type' =>'click', 'name' =>'服務支持','key'  =>'SUPPORT')
)
),
array(
'name' =>'更多',
'sub_button' =>array(
array('type' =>'click', 'name' =>'關于我們','key'  =>'ABOUT_US'),
array('type' =>'click', 'name' =>'聯系我們','key'  =>'CONTACT_US'),
array('type' =>'view', 'name' =>'提交反饋','url'  =>'http://www.example.com/help/feedback')
)
)
);
// 將菜單數組轉為JSON格式
$jsonmenu = json_encode($buttons);
// 向微信服務器發送菜單設置請求
$url = "https://api.weixin.qq.com/cgi-bin/menu/create?access_token=".$access_token;
$result = https_request($url, $jsonmenu);

其次,我們可以通過PHP語言自動回復微信用戶的信息。自動回復是微信公眾號的重要功能之一,可以方便快捷地處理用戶咨詢、投訴等信息。通過PHP開發的自動回復,可以方便地設置各類關鍵詞回復,滿足不同用戶的需求。例如,用戶發送關鍵詞“咨詢”時,自動回復介紹公司產品;發送關鍵詞“投訴”時,自動回復處理流程等。

<?php
// 獲取用戶發送的消息類型和內容
$MsgType = $postObj->MsgType;
$Content = trim($postObj->Content);
// 根據用戶發送的消息類型進行不同的回復
switch ($MsgType) {
case "text":
if ($Content == "Hello") {
$textTpl = "<xml><ToUserName><![CDATA[%s]]></ToUserName><FromUserName><![CDATA[%s]]></FromUserName><CreateTime>%s</CreateTime><MsgType><![CDATA[text]]></MsgType><Content><![CDATA[%s]]></Content></xml>";
$resultStr = sprintf($textTpl, $fromUsername, $toUsername, $time, "歡迎關注微信公眾號!");
} else {
$resultStr = "發生了一些未知的錯誤!";
}
break;
case "image":
$resultStr = "您發送的是圖片消息!";
break;
case "voice":
$resultStr = "您發送的是語音消息!";
break;
case "video":
$resultStr = "您發送的是視頻消息!";
break;
case "location":
$resultStr = "您發送的是地理位置消息!";
break;
case "link":
$resultStr = "您發送的是鏈接消息!";
break;
default:
$resultStr = "您發送的是未知類型消息!";
break;
}
// 輸出回復消息給用戶
echo $resultStr;

除此之外,通過PHP語言還可以輕松實現微信公眾平臺的消息推送和數據統計等功能,方便開發者對微信公眾平臺進行二次開發。值得一提的是,通過PHP開發的微信公眾平臺,在對接微信第三方平臺時需要避免出現“搶關注”的問題,否則可能會導致微信公眾號被封禁,給開發者帶來不必要的麻煩。

綜上所述,PHP語言開發的微信公眾平臺以簡單易用、方便靈活的特點受到了眾多開發者的青睞。通過PHP語言開發,可以輕松實現微信菜單、自動回復、消息推送、數據統計等功能,并為開發者提供了無限的可能。相信在不久的將來,PHP語言開發的微信公眾平臺將會越來越普及,為用戶提供更加便捷的服務。